Transaction dcf830e7032566377bdeb86461231f9962f793721880d60e53c7f86639af58c7

1 Input
2 Outputs
  • dcf830e7032566377bdeb86461231f9962f793721880d60e53c7f86639af58c7:0
  • value  415000
    address  3LcL3ev8sqmQZumkY9NiyTKtBLgjzpFK6n
  • dcf830e7032566377bdeb86461231f9962f793721880d60e53c7f86639af58c7:1
  • value  582452
    address  12A4CRxGGEqyeGUEj7RaheKmCtHGEbKTE4